Job Title: Quality ManagerLocation: Denton, Greater ManchesterSalary: CompetetiveHours: 8:00am – 5:00pm Monday to Thursday | 8:00am – 4:00pm Friday (discretionary finish at 2:00pm)Holidays: 25 days’ holiday plus bank holidaysBonus: Discretionary 6-month bonus scheme (subject to business performance)Are you looking for a new and exciting challenge within the engineering sector?We are seeking a highly motivated and experienced Quality Manager to join our precision engineering manufacturing site in Denton. This is a fantastic opportunity to work in a forward-thinking, supportive environment with strong career development potential.About the CompanyMy client are a precision engineering company with over 40 years of successful supply to the aerospace industry, holding AS9100 accreditation and approvals from leading OEMs such as Airbus, BAE Systems, and MBDA. The company prides itself on delivering right-first-time solutions and consistently exceeding customer expectations.Due to the recent departure of the previous Quality Manager, they are now seeking a talented individual to lead the Quality function and help shape the company’s continued success.About the OpportunityThis leadership role involves full accountability for the Quality function, including managing day-to-day quality activities at the site. As part of the Production leadership team, you will play a key role in the strategic direction of the business and have the opportunity to develop and refine the Quality Management System to meet both current and future needs.This position is not hands-on inspection work — instead, it focuses on leadership, compliance, and continuous improvement across all quality operations.Main Responsibilities⦁ Act as the site focal point for Quality, both internally and externally (customers and regulatory bodies).⦁ Manage and mentor the inspection team (3 Inspectors) to ensure consistent, high-quality output.⦁ Ensure all Non-Conformance activities are completed, including effective root cause analysis and corrective actions.⦁ Own and manage the First Article Inspection Report (FAIR) process, ensuring on-time completion.⦁ Maintain and develop the company’s Integrated Management System (IMS) to AS9100 standards.⦁ Develop, update, and deploy procedures and processes (e.g., Calibration, NCRs, CAPAs).⦁ Ensure all quality documentation is accurate, relevant, and up to date.⦁ Liaise with the Divisional Quality team and external auditors for guidance, support, and compliance reviews.⦁ Lead quality improvement initiatives and support companywide continuous improvement efforts.⦁ Contribute to business-wide strategic decisions as part of the leadership team.Essential Skills & Experience⦁ Proven track record as a Quality Engineer or Quality Manager within a precision engineering or aerospace environment.⦁ Strong understanding of AS9100 and FAIR processes.⦁ Skilled in root cause analysis and problem-solving techniques.⦁ Excellent communication and stakeholder management skills.⦁ Ability to read and interpret 2D and 3D engineering drawings.⦁ Proficient in Quality tools and systems used in a manufacturing environment.Desirable Skills⦁ Experience in machining and/or CMM processes.⦁ Demonstrated leadership and team management capability.⦁ Project management experience.⦁ Familiarity with risk analysis, and risk & opportunity management.Personal Attributes⦁ Engaging and inspiring leader.⦁ Confident, credible, and customer-focused.⦁ Positive and proactive approach.⦁ Strong communicator with the ability to influence at all levels.⦁ Detail-oriented with a mindset for simplification and clarity.Team & Environment⦁ The Quality department comprises three Inspectors based in a temperature-controlled inspection area adjacent to the shop floor.⦁ The Quality Manager is based in the engineering office, working closely with Production, Engineering, and the Directors.Benefits Package⦁ 25 days’ holiday plus bank holidays⦁ Discretionary 6-month bonus scheme (subject to business performance)⦁ Pension scheme: 5% employee contribution / 3% employer contribution⦁ Employee Assistance Programme (EAP) and counselling sessions⦁ Perkbox memberships⦁ Cycle to Work scheme⦁ Costco membership⦁ Flexible, supportive working environment with opportunities for professional development
